Human hair wigs should be washed and rinsed in cool or room temperature water. Most labels recommend filling a sink with cool water and a capful of synthetic or human hair wig shampoo. Make sure to use shampoo and conditioner made specifically for your wig type.To wash the wig, you need to gently swirl it around in the soapy water and then let it soak for 10 to 20 minutes. Rinse the wig very, very well with cool or room temperature water. Carefully squeeze the excess water from the wig and let it drip into the sink. Never twist the hair around to get rid of extra water, it will stretch and tear the strands.If your wig needs conditioning, use a rinse during the washing process or a spray afterwards, according to your preference. Place the wig on a thick, dry towel and let it start to air dry. If needed, you can transfer the damp wig to a raised form to finish drying.Wigs are one way of changing the style, color, or length of your hair. A wig does not need that you sew in, fuse in, glue in, or clip in any hair but either of these can be used to hold it in place if desired. Depending on the type of wig you purchase, they can be expensive. Wigs are commonly utilized for numerous different factors: by cancer patients who have lost their hair due to chemotherapy, as portion of a costume, in weddings, to cover other types of baldness, and for a selection of other reasons. Human hair wigs are produced of true human hair and price more than the alternative synthetic hair wigs but they look more natural. Wigs can be attached with pins, glue, tape, sewn in, or custom fitted to your head requiring no form of attachment except the power of suction.
